Output 542ddd63ec100c831797590468c0cf7cfee904eb38cbe401d58e0d5d1cb0b203:2

value
31587800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e52af5a90867d1754bcb72140940f04b272e0035 OP_EQUAL
address
3Nak8MmsxABF8AKKorcxwEV2oyqhBoogy1
transaction
542ddd63ec100c831797590468c0cf7cfee904eb38cbe401d58e0d5d1cb0b203
spent
true